please help convince me to revise for my exam tomorrow! by Existentialcrumble in adhdwomen

[–]Existentialcrumble[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

yay! i am a physics student so i dont know if our revision styles are the same at all, but will say i went into this not knowing how to revise because of being a *gifted kid* and slowly as my grades started slipping i have had to teach myself to revise.

assuming I have access to the entire syllabus i am being tested on, my revision process is: read through the entire content you are supposed to know, making a note of anything you need to memorise. These can be visually appealing, so i like to put everything on 1 mind map and use highlighters. Also make a note of anything you don't understand conceptually. then, come back to the things you don't understand and 'study' until you understand. This can be asking for help, using the textbook, google, or (one of the only good use-cases, imo) ask ai to explain. once you understand everything theoretically, start practicing for the exam, using past papers/practice questions. If you have time, start trying to answer questions open-book, then closed-book, then under time pressure, and then review your answers to see how you can improve.

"YoU sHoUlD gEt UsEd To LoUd EnViRoNmEnTaL nOiSe If YoU wAnT tO sUrViVe In ThIs WoRlD" by thingummywatt in AutisticWithADHD

[–]Existentialcrumble 5 points6 points  (0 children)

something i do when i get really irritated is double up noise-cancelling earbuds with noise-cancelling headphones. it can be a bit uncomfortable so i cant do it for long, but just put them both on noise cancelling mode and play your music through the earbuds and it works a lot better. I have the soundcore p30i earbuds which are amazing value for money for the quality that they give (only around $30 i believe).

Also in areas you can control (like your bedroom) you could put up sound panelling on the walls and a thick rug/curtains to dampen the incoming noise.
